Ten years of active middle ear implantation for sensorineural hearing loss
Maurizio Barbara1, Chiara Filippi1, Edoardo Covelli1
1a ENT Clinic, NESMOS Department, Medicine and Psychology , Sapienza University , Rome , Italy.
Objectives:
To evaluate long-term benefits of a totally implantable active middle ear implant (AMEI) that has been used in a single implanting center for over 10 years.
Methods:
Forty-one subjects who underwent implantation with an Esteem® AMEI during a 10-years period were evaluated on the auditory benefits, as derived from pure tone and speech audiometry tests. The analysis included a comparison with a conventional hearing aid, the problematics related to the battery duration and surgical replacement and, finally, the complication rate.
Results:
Over 80% of the implanted subjects maintained over time a satisfactory auditory gain, ranging from 10 to over 30 dB in respect to the unaided situation, as mean at 0.5, 1, 2 and 4 kHz. In more than 60% of them, an improvement has also been found at 4 and 8 kHz. Battery duration varied according to the severity of the hearing loss and to the daily use of the device. No major post-operative complications were recorded, whilst explantation was necessary in five subjects, although none for device failure.
Conclusions:
The Esteem® can be considered a reliable device for rehabilitation of sensorineural hearing loss in alternative to conventional hearing aids.
